Overview of LP38691SD-ADJ/NOPB

The LP38691SD-ADJ/NOPB is a voltage regulator designed by Texas Instruments, renowned for its high efficiency and reliability. This component is particularly tailored for applications requiring a stable and adjustable output voltage. It is widely used in various electronic devices to ensure a steady supply of power, which is crucial for maintaining the performance and longevity of these devices.

Key Features

  • Adjustable Output Voltage: Allows customization of output voltage to meet specific requirements of different applications.
  • High Efficiency: Ensures minimal energy loss during voltage regulation, making it suitable for energy-sensitive applications.
  • Thermal Protection: Equipped with features to prevent overheating, thereby enhancing its reliability and lifespan.
  • Low Dropout: Offers efficient performance even in conditions where the difference between input and output voltage is minimal.

Technical Specifications

  • Output Voltage Range: Adjustable, catering to a wide range of voltage requirements.
  • Input Voltage: Supports a broad range of input voltages, making it versatile for different power sources.
  • Load Regulation: Maintains a consistent output voltage even under varying load conditions.
  • Package Type: Comes in a user-friendly package, enabling easy integration into various circuit designs.

Applications

The LP38691SD-ADJ/NOPB is ideally suited for a variety of electronic applications. It is commonly used in consumer electronics like smartphones and laptops, where a stable power supply is essential for optimal functionality. Additionally, its reliability and efficiency make it a preferred choice in industrial applications, such as in automated machinery and control systems. Its adjustable voltage feature also finds use in research and development sectors, where customized voltage settings are often required for experimental setups.
